首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库创建不了用户

MySQL数据库创建用户是通过使用CREATE USER语句来实现的。CREATE USER语句允许我们创建一个新的数据库用户,并为其指定用户名和密码。创建用户后,可以使用GRANT语句授予用户不同级别的权限,以控制其对数据库的访问。

下面是一个完善且全面的答案:

MySQL数据库是一种开源的关系型数据库管理系统,广泛应用于Web开发和其他应用程序中。它支持多种操作系统和编程语言,并提供可扩展性和可靠性。MySQL数据库创建用户的过程如下:

  1. 首先,使用root用户登录到MySQL数据库服务器。root用户具有最高级别的权限,可以执行管理数据库用户和权限的操作。
  2. 使用以下语法创建一个新的数据库用户: C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 这里,'username'是要创建的用户的名称,'host'是用户的主机名或IP地址,'password'是用户的密码。可以使用%来代表所有主机。
  3. 可选地,可以使用GRANT语句为用户分配不同级别的权限。例如,授予SELECT、INSERT、UPDATE、DELETE等权限: GRANT SELECT, INSERT, UPDATE, DELETE ON database.table TO 'username'@'host'; 这里,'database'是数据库名称,'table'是表名称。
  4. 最后,使用FLUSH PRIVILEGES语句刷新权限: FLUSH PRIVILEGES; 这将使新的用户和权限立即生效。

MySQL数据库的优势包括:

  • 可扩展性:MySQL支持大规模的数据存储和处理,能够处理数百万甚至数十亿的数据记录。
  • 可靠性:MySQL提供了数据备份、故障恢复和数据安全性等功能,确保数据的安全和完整性。
  • 性能:MySQL通过优化查询和索引技术,提供了快速的数据访问和处理能力。
  • 兼容性:MySQL与各种编程语言和操作系统都具有良好的兼容性,可以轻松集成到不同的开发环境中。

MySQL数据库适用于各种应用场景,包括:

  • 网站和应用程序:MySQL被广泛用于开发Web应用程序和网站,存储用户信息、日志数据和其他关键数据。
  • 企业应用程序:许多企业使用MySQL作为其关键业务应用程序的后端数据库,如客户关系管理系统、库存管理系统等。
  • 数据分析和报告:MySQL可以用于存储和处理大量数据,用于数据分析、生成报告和支持决策。
  • 云原生应用:MySQL可以在云环境中部署和管理,提供高可用性、可扩展性和灵活性。

腾讯云提供了MySQL数据库的相关产品,包括云数据库MySQL、数据库备份、数据库审计等。您可以访问腾讯云的官方网站了解更多关于这些产品的信息: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

21分43秒

13创建用户账号信息数据库.avi

3分22秒

02、mysql之新建数据库和用户

10分27秒

Python MySQL数据库开发 23 留言板数据库的设计与创建 学习猿地

3分42秒

MySQL数据库迁移

1时31分

MySQL数据库安装

14分42秒

19创建删除用户

18分40秒

Python MySQL数据库开发 1 MySQL数据库基本介绍 学习猿地

16分18秒

163_尚硅谷_实时电商项目_数据库表创建以及查询MySQL工具类封装

27分34秒

Python MySQL数据库开发 19 Mysql数据库导入导出和授权 学习猿地

14分3秒

MySQL数据库概述及准备

22.3K
5分54秒

07-Servlet-2/19-尚硅谷-书城项目-创建数据库和t_user用户表

9分59秒

07-部署-创建元数据库

领券